MANCHESTER UNITED OFFERS NEW INTERNET SERVICE TO BRING FANS EVEN CLOSER TO OLD TRAFFORD

World's largest football club teams up with UUNET to make it even easier for fans to connect to the club

Manchester United Football Club is to offer free Internet access to its fans. The club has chosen UUNET, the Internet services division of MCI WorldCom, to deliver ManUFree.net to UK fans from July 15th 1999.

The initiative will be a major first for any free online access service as Manchester United and UUNET are currently developing a similar package that will be available for its international supporters and global markets. This will begin roll-out later in the year.

UK subscribers to ManUFree.net will receive five e-mail addresses in the form of: xx@manchesterunited.net. E-mail messages will be accessible from any PC connected to the Internet via a WWW browser interface. The package will also include dial-up access to the Internet via an '0845' telephone number charged at local call rates; access to the official Manchester United online news server providing up to the minute club news, as well as 20MB of web space for fans to create their own personal Web site.

The service is supported by a helpdesk, contactable online or via the telephone (charged at 50 pence per minute in the UK), providing advice with any problems encountered using the service, e.g. registration, software installation, sending/receiving e-mail, connection to the network, accessing the News server.

Manchester United is using the global Internet infrastructure of UUNET to deliver the high quality service. This is the highest capacity, most widely deployed Internet network in the world. Manchester United already uses the UUNET network to run its popular Web site, www.manutd.com, which, among other things, delivers live radio commentary on all of Manchester United's Premiership matches to a worldwide audience.

David Gill, Finance Director of Manchester United PLC, said:

"The aim of the Manchester United Web site is to connect our fans both in the UK and around the world to the Club and offer a comprehensive set of online services that they can enjoy. ManUFree.net is a natural extension of this offering. However, it is paramount that this service, as with all Manchester United offerings, be of the highest quality. UUNET has met our demanding criteria for an Internet Service Provider that could provide a robust, reliable and truly global Internet network for our fans around the globe."

UUNET's UK Marketing Director, Joe Clift, added: "The relationship with Manchester United signifies an exciting phase for UUNET. The ongoing investment of US$2 million per day in our global Internet infrastructure has enabled us to develop and support the innovative services of world class organisations, such as Manchester United. I have no doubt that this alliance of 'premier providers' will deliver an exciting future for the club, its millions of fans and, of course, for UUNET."

Online registration facilities for ManUFree.net can be found at www.manutd.com or obtained via CD-Rom from "Manchester United" the official club magazine.
